How many consecutive days could the Island carry out 1000 Covid-19 tests per day?
Douglas South MHK, Claire Christian, will put that question to Health and Social Care Minister, David Ashford MHK, when Tynwald meets for its monthly sitting next week.
Mrs Christian wants to know how this could be done with the current on-Island reagents, consumables, and staffing already in place.
Her query will be heard when the court convenes next Tuesday from 10.30am.
